As Elgin wakes from a centuries-long sleep, it’s to the memory of danger and
loss. Even in the confusion of re-animation, he wonders if this time she’ll be
there. But then he remembers the mysterious Visitor and the perilous mission
that took Frances from him, and darkness closes in again. Even so, there’s
always the hope that this time will be different, that they will have found a
way. It was always like this. Hope would always rise again, no matter how often
it was struck down.
